A rotary plastic track potentiometer is a type of potentiometer used to control the electrical voltage in a circuit. It is so called because of its construction, which includes a conductive plastic coated track on which a slider moves according to the position of its axis.
The plastic track potentiometer provides a linear analogue output of the ratio type of the supply voltage. Our products can be used for data acquisition systems as well as position control systems.
